Quicklists
public yes 10:39

The Technological Singularity is Near

by admin
49 Views
public yes 42:26

Internet from space | DW Documentary

by admin
16 Views
public yes 24:43
public yes 09:47
public yes 11:31
public yes 10:08
public yes 00:43
public yes 53:08

Particles Unknown:神秘粒子

by admin
32 Views